Welcome to the Tobie Norris, a Knead pub since 2006 but built in 1280. Packed full of history, the Tobie Norris is an enchanting, three-story pub with casual dining areas, function rooms, a lively bar, conservatory and sheltered terraced garden. Quirky through-and-through, the Tobie Norris is well known for it’s charming atmosphere, fantastic beverages and delicious dishes.
